Palm Authentication using Biometric Security Systems

Darshan Parate, Mansi Tanna, Kajal Singh

Abstract

With identity fraud in our society reaching unprecedented proportions and with an increasing emphasis on the emerging automatic personal identification applications, biometric-base verification, especially Palm-base identification, is receiving lot of attention. There are two major short coming of the traditional approaches to Palm represntation. The widely used minutiae-base representation does not utilize a significant component of the rich discriminatory information available in the Palm. Local ridg structures cannot be completely characterized by minutae. Further, minutae-based matching has difficulty in quickly matching two Palm image containing different number of unregistered minutiae points. The proposed filter base algorithm use a bank of Gabor filters to capture both local and global details in a Palm as a compact fixed length Finger Code. The Palm match is based on the Euclidean distance between the two corresponding FingerCodes and hence is fast. We are able to achieve a verification accuracy which is only marginally inferior to the best results of minutiae-based algorithms published in the open literature [1]. Our system performs better than a state-of-the-art minutiae-based system when the performance requirement of the application system does not demand a very low wrong acceptance rate. Finally, we show this the matching performance can be improved by combining the decisions of the matchers based on complementary (minutiae-based and filter-based) Palm information.
